大家在學習AutoCAD的過程中,難免會遇到一些問題,下面針對一些常見問題為大家一一解決。
1、AutoCAD字體亂碼的三種解決方法
1)、在當前發生亂碼的文檔中,新輸入若干字符,此時該字符顯示為正常漢字。此后,使用特性匹配工具(傳說中的格式刷),以正常顯示的文字為源,令亂碼字符與正常文字特性匹配即可。此法優點是便于操作和理解,缺點是在有大量亂碼的情況下效率較低。但是,如果所有文字都在一個圖層中,則可以將非文本圖層關閉,用框選的方式特性匹配即可瞬間匹配所有文字。

2)、在當前文檔中,修改文字樣式。設置字體為txt.shx,大字體為gbcbig.shx。完成后確認,回到繪圖界面,如沒有變化,使用regen重生成下看效果。
3)、將文檔關閉,重新打開,在打開過程中遇到字體選擇對話框的時候,直接選擇gbcbig.shx即可。
2、圖紙轉換過程中出現字體不匹配、亂碼等
1)、ACAD的低版本文件,如R13(及R13以下)的DWG文件,用R14(及R14以上)版本打開時,即使正確地選擇了漢字字形文件,還是會出現漢字亂碼,原因是R14(及R14以上)與R13(及R13以下)采用的代碼頁不同。解決辦法:可到AutoDesk公司主頁下載代碼頁轉換工具wnewcp工具進行轉換,如原圖為簡體中文,選擇轉換為GB2312或ANSI936均可。
2)、在一個塊里寫字,如在標題欄里寫字,一些內容太長造成文字出界,在acad2000以前的版本里無法調整塊里面的文字屬性(即無法調整塊中塊),只能采用炸開的辦法再調整文字屬性。解決辦法:升級到acad2002,它的塊里面可以更改下一層塊的屬性。
3)、當數字與文字混合輸入時,高度不一,通常來說數字比文字的高度大一點。解決辦法:我通常數字用用style指令指 定數字用GBENOR字體(ACAD自帶,字高比其它字體矮),文字用HZTXT字體(如沒有HZTXT字體,可根據感覺另選字體代替)。
4)、打開其他公司的CAD圖紙,提示無圖紙中的某字體,但用其他字體替 代后,出現亂碼。解決辦法:新建一文檔,將該CAD圖紙作為一個塊插入,亂碼將會消失(但字體會與原圖有出入,若需100 %準確,則需要對方通過匹配的字體)。
5)、用中文版的PROE中Pro/Drawing出好的工程圖,當你把它轉成DWG后用AutoCAD打開后,你無論在ACAD中如何設中文字體,把它炸開(因文字由PROE轉DWG時全成圖塊了),都無法正常顯示PROE中的中文字體。解決辦法:轉時先不要直接轉成DWG格式,先轉成DXF格式(這樣在ACAD中文字就不會成為一個圖塊),再用AutoCAD打開這個DXF文件,這時此ACAD文件字體風格是純英文字符,用style指令來改變字體風格,采用BIG FONT,選一種較為合適的中文字體,然后應用,你會發現,PROE中標的中文字全回復過來了。經網友試驗,SYFS.SHX字體與,PROE的字體相差無幾。
6)、圖紙為實心字,打引印時出現空心字體。解決辦法:將ACAD參數TEXTFILL的參數值由0改為1。
3、CAD多行文字為什么會亂碼
AutoCAD提供的多行文字編輯器就象一個小的文本編輯工具,低版本的與寫字板類似,功能非常少,隨著版本的升級,功能也越來越豐富。由于功能的增加,文字本身會增加很多用于控制格式的編碼,低版本如果不支持類似編碼,就有可能導致無法顯示這些效果,從而導致文字顯示與高版本不一致。這種問題不僅可能出現在用打開AutoCAD圖紙的情況,也有可能出現在AutoCAD不同版本之間,類似的有些問題是無法解決的,只能根據需要再調整一下格式。
此外如果多行文字的編碼因為某種原因出現錯誤,顯示也會不正常。有些版本可以檢測這些錯誤,忽略一些錯誤代碼或對代碼進行修復,有些可能無法處理這些錯誤,這也會導致不同版本CAD中文字顯示效果不同。
文中圖片素材來源網絡,如有侵權請聯系刪除